Knappogue Castle 12 Year Cognac Cask Single Malt Irish Whiskey

Single Malt Irish Whiskey | 46% ABV | 750 mL

Process & Profile

Knappogue Castle 12 Year Cognac Cask is a triple-distilled Irish single malt aged for a minimum of 12 years in ex-bourbon barrels and finished in French Cognac casks made from Limousin oak. This limited release showcases the elegance of Irish whiskey enriched by the fruity, oaky influence of Cognac maturation. Non-chill filtered and naturally colored, it retains full flavor integrity at 46% ABV.

Tasting Notes

  • Nose: Caramel, honeyed malt, vanilla bean, toasted oak, and soft orchard fruit

  • Palate: Creamy mouthfeel with baked apple, almond, nougat, and light spice

  • Finish: Long, smooth, and gently warming with lingering notes of fruit, nuts, and soft oak

What Makes It Special

  • Aged 12 years in bourbon barrels with a finishing period in Limousin oak Cognac casks

  • Bottled at 46% ABV for enhanced depth and a full-bodied sipping experience

  • Non-chill filtered and naturally colored

  • Offers a refined twist on classic Irish whiskey with French finishing influence

  • Limited edition release that highlights cask innovation in Irish distilling

How to Enjoy

Best served neat or with a splash of spring water to explore its complexity. Pairs well with crème brûlée, roasted nuts, or soft cheeses like Brie or triple-cream Camembert.
